Remove one project out of a workflow scheme

oliver.schulz July 21, 2022 edited

Hi, we use one workflow scheme for multiple projects. For only one of those projects I want to make a lot of workflow changes, so I created in a new playground scheme with new flows first.

Now I'm wondering, how can I add my new workflows step by step to this one specific project? (I don't want to overwhelm my team).

My approach would be, copy the existing old workflow scheme, name it 'New Workflow Scheme'. Switch the scheme of this particular project to 'New Workflow Scheme'.

Then replace the single workflows step by step with the playground workflows.

What do you think, is that the way to go?

Hi @oliver.schulz 

Yeah this method sounds about right - you will need a separate workflow scheme in order for the projects to use different workflows. You will also need to clone the actual workflow within this scheme which you wish to change, as when you clone a workflow scheme, the same original workflows are still associated with the newly cloned scheme

Welcome to the Atlassian Community!

You're getting projects and workflows the wrong way around.  You do not remove a project from a workflow, you remove a workflow from a project.

So it's the same answer.  You need to create a new workflow scheme and apply it to the project(s) you want to remove the workflow from.
